    Abstract: A method of remotely controlling a device at a location is provided. A dataset is received from each of a plurality of different locations, comprising at least one data value of at least one monitorable device at the respective location. Based on the dataset, a user interface can be generated, comprising a primary interface element having plurality of matrix positions mapped to a surface of a sphere. In the user interface, an interactive object icon is displayed which is representative of a monitorable device positioned at the respective matrix position. A scale of each interactive object icon is indicative of the data value of the said monitorable device. After receiving a user input at an interactive object icon, a processor retrieves and displays the data value of a monitorable device associated with the interactive object icon, and a device is controlled at the location to perform a physical function.

    Abstract: Haptic feedback for communication of relevant information is provided. Oftentimes when using content narration to read or author a document, it is desirable to notify the user of a presence of meta-information. Aspects of a haptic feedback system avoid adding data to an audio stream, and instead, use haptic feedback technology to communicate information about a presence and type of meta-information in relation to content being narrated. Device functionality can be improved by enabling communication of relevant information through non-auditory cues that are consumable by sight-impaired users. By employing haptic technologies as described herein, users are enabled to feel when certain meta-information is available, and are further enabled to interact with the meta-information to receive additional information associated with the meta-information.

    Abstract: An electronic device displays a control user interface that includes a plurality of control affordances. The device detects an input by a contact at a location on the touch-sensitive surface that corresponds to a control affordance, of the plurality of control affordances, on the display. In response to detecting the input, when a characteristic intensity of the contact does not meet an intensity threshold, the device toggles a function of a control that corresponds to the control affordance; and when the characteristic intensity of the contact meets the intensity threshold, the device displays modification options for the control that correspond to the control affordance. While displaying the modification options, the device detects a second input that activates a modification option of the modification options. The device modifies the control that corresponds to the control affordance in accordance with the activated modification option.

    Abstract: An adaptive layout and workflow engine. The adaptive layout and workflow engine allows various applications to dynamically render scaled views of content based on the characteristics of the display on the device being used to consume the content. The adaptive layout and workflow engine may select an appropriate view of the content to render based on the size, resolution, or aspect ratio of the display. The rendered size of the content and/or the user interface of the content application is evaluated relative to the characteristics of the display. Embodiments may provide different controls via the user interfaces based on the characteristics of the display and/or content. The adaptive layout and workflow engine may provide customized work flows via the user interface to improve the user experience depending on the display capabilities of the device used to consume the content.
